a new greasemonkey script - Feed:Eater

For the Firefox users out there annoyed by Firefox’s handling of the feed: URI scheme mess, may I please present Feed:Eater, a greasemonkey script which silently replaces feed:http:// URLs with auto-subscribe links that work in your favorite online feed-reader!
Feed:Eater supports: Bloglines, Netvibes, My Yahoo, Google Reader, Pageflakes, NewsGator, AOL, Rojo, and Pluck.
Download it here: Install […]

Mixing Life and Work Blows when your Work is Dilluting your Life

I discussed some of the risks of an un-anchored sabbatical tonight with J–. he strongly recommends working at least partially within the confines of academia to reap the network benefits (enthusiasm, rich resources) of an academic system. He’s probably right. i’m going to try and schedule something with MR and/or PH tomorrow, even though i […]

instiki - a ruby on rails wiki now hacked for your mobile pleasure

so far, i’ve modded Instiki to have new stylesheets for a cleaner look, and a set of blackberry and mobile device optimizations, including:

adding javascript show/hide for the wiki editing help and hiding it by default
shortening the help text and moving it below the page body when editing so you don’t have to scroll past it
reducing […]

some documentation on learning the Monome 40h

…is now available on the Tools to Make Tools
Wiki. stay tuned for patch uploads soon.

Spy on my code commits

Before i knew about things like attention streams and Trac, there was CIA.
CIA is a great concept that happened almost before its time — a website for developers to stream status information into from their open source projects. CIA was like the giant train station schedule sign clicking away as a million trains, or coders, […]

just type a description and (optional) comments

the Blackberry will include the URL for you and automatically figure out your Feed Me Links user ID based on your email address.

Past Projects

[editor’s note: please excuse the broken links for some of these projects — in the server migration, some of the older files are no longer live. email me for code samples or examples]
Past independent projects include:
dd {padding-bottom: 2.0em;} .language {display: none; height: 0px; margin: 0px;}

Command Runner
web-based interactive command executor
Interwoven / Perl

Feed Me […]

Migrating Your Wordpress blog to a New Server

is not quite as easy as it could be. (or, maybe i just did it the hard way — i do that sometimes.)
follow these steps for a clean, if not necessarily painless, migration:

dump the WP database from your old server to a file:
mysqldup -u username -ppassword databasename > dump.sql
download and unpack (but do not “install”) […]

Request for Aid: Javascript Event Dominance and Submission

I’m having trouble with a GMail reverse-engineering problem and I thought I’d post it here in case anyone had some ideas for breaking through my little impasse. Here’s the problem: I’m adding (decorating, in GoF-speak) an event handler to a GMail control — specifically, the Send button. My objective is for the existing Send button, […]

spam sxirmish

i am now using sxore (from sxip, of the identity 2.0 presentation fame) to moderate comment spam and verify the identity of comment posters. this is a good thing.